Question:
Can a 2005 dodge ram 1500 5.7L hemi pull a 2009 bumper pull travel trailer
asked by: Tom
Expert Reply:
In order to find out if your vehicle is equipped to pull a certain trailer you will need to find the towing capacity of your vehicle and make sure the weight of the trailer does not exceed this figure. Now, there are several different towing capacities for a 2005 Dodge Ram 1500 with the 5.7L V8 that can range from 4,690 lbs to 9,150 lbs. If you can provide me with your cab style, transmission type, axle ratio, and gross combined weight rating (GCWR) then I could give you an exact capacity. Unfortunately, there is not a standard gross weight of all travel trailers but if you can give me the make, model, and floorplan I may be able to find this out for you.
If the vehicle's towing capacity does exceed the trailer's gross weight then you are going to need a trailer hitch, wiring harness, and ball mount/hitch ball in order to tow it.
